Vehicle: 1997 Mitsubishi Galant DE 2.4 L4 GAS
Testing the refrigerant system for leaks is one of the most important phases of troubleshooting. One or more of the methods outlined will prove useful in detecting leaks or checking connections if service work is performed. Before beginning any leak test, attach a manifold gauge set and note pressure. If little or no pressure is indicated, a partial charge must be installed. Check all connections, compressor head gasket, oil filler plug and compressor shaft seal for leaks.

Vehicle: 2001 Mitsubishi Galant 2.4 L4 GAS
Service Brakes
Rear brakes should be adjusted after rear brake service or before adjusting parking brake. These brakes have self-adjusting shoe mechanisms that maintain correct brake lining to drum clearances at all times. The automatic self-adjusting mechanism operates whenever the parking brake lever is applied on all models except the Duo-Servo type. These contain a self-adjusting mechanism which operates when the brakes are applied as the vehicle is moving rearward.
